I got mine for $40 used. I bought it to use for vocals - which I do, but I also bring it home from my practice studio to doodle around with guitar, sounds really good, the od is crap but the fuzz is pretty tasty, wasn't expecting that.

 

The reverb is awesome, I wonder if it is the Holy Grail sound engine...you have control over the wet/dry and decay so its almost like a HG+

 

Tremolo is really good, as a little reverb bit in the tremolo to give it more space, pitch shifter is fun too.

 

Basically if you can get one for a good price it's worth it in my opinion.

I had one for awhile. It wasn't bad little pedal ... but trying to fit a multi-ish FX box into a normal stomp rig is tough. I sold it and (eventually) got a Mayo, an RV-3 and a Semaphore. Isolated all the good stuff and couldn't be happier.

 

As far as the pedal goes, it's pretty easy to get good tones out of.

 

The verb is rather Holy Grail-ish.

The trem is pretty good.

IMO, the detune is only good for divebombs or slight chorusy stuff.

The distortion is basic.

The fuzz is actually pretty good.

 

Not a bad little pedal ... but it wasn't for me.
